An area of land at WWT Slimbridge has been transformed into a beautiful butterfly garden thanks to the generosity of Avon Metals.

The Gloucester Company donated £3,500 enabling Slimbridge horticultural team to clear the land and to create beds planted with a wide range of plant species which are attractive to butterflies and insects.

John Verdon, Chief Operating Officer from Avon Metals, came to officially open the garden on Thursday (August 29th).
